
Buckwheat Pasta
Buckwheat pasta is a gluten-free alternative to traditional wheat-based pasta, made primarily from buckwheat flour. It has a nutty, earthy flavor and a slightly chewy texture, making it a favorite among those seeking healthier or gluten-free options. Typically dark in color, buckwheat pasta is rich in nutrients like fiber, protein, and essential minerals, making it a wholesome choice for balanced meals. Its robust taste pairs well with hearty sauces and vegetables, making it a versatile ingredient in various cuisines. Common Uses
- Serve buckwheat pasta with creamy mushroom sauces or roasted vegetables for a hearty and nutritious meal.
- Use buckwheat pasta in cold salads, paired with fresh herbs, olive oil, and lemon for a refreshing dish.
- Incorporate buckwheat pasta into stir-fries with soy sauce, sesame oil, and colorful vegetables for an Asian-inspired dish.
- Pair buckwheat pasta with pesto or tomato-based sauces for a classic Italian-style dinner.
- Use buckwheat pasta as a base for vegan or vegetarian dishes, adding plant-based proteins like tofu or chickpeas.
- Create a warm, comforting soup by adding buckwheat pasta to broths with seasonal vegetables and herbs.

Health Benefits
- Rich in fiber, promoting healthy digestion and aiding in weight management.
- High in protein, making it a great option for vegetarians and vegans.
- Naturally gluten-free, suitable for individuals with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ease.
- Contains essential minerals like magnesium, which supports heart health and muscle function.
- Packed with antioxidants, helping to reduce inflammation and boost overall immunity.
- Low glycemic index, making it a good choice for maintaining stable blood sugar levels.
Storage Tips
Store buckwheat pasta in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Once opened, keep it in an airtight container to maintain freshness and prevent it from absorbing odors or humidity. If cooked, refrigerate the pasta in a sealed container and consume within 3-5 days. Avoid freezing cooked buckwheat pasta as it may alter its texture.
